Abstract:
PROBLEM TO BE SOLVED: To inexpensively recover metal iron from decarburization refining slag and preliminary dephosphorized slag which are produced in a steelmaking process and utilize the steelmaking slag as a civil engineering and construction material or an environmental improvement material, which do not cause volume expansion and clouding phenomenon of seawater, and further as raw materials for phosphate fertilizers.SOLUTION: In the method for resource recovery from steelmaking slag, decarburization refining slag produced in decarburization refining of molten iron in a converter and preliminary dephosphorized slag produced in preliminary dephosphorization treatment of molten iron are mixed such that a basicity (mass% of CaO/mass% of SiO) of the mixture after the mixing of the slag is 1.5-2.8, reduction treatment for the reduction of an iron oxide in the slag is subjected to the mixture using a reducing agent containing one or more selected from carbon, silicon and aluminum, and the slag after the reduction treatment is used as one or more of a civil engineering and construction material, an environmental improvement material and raw materials for phosphate fertilizers, while metal iron obtained through the reduction treatment is used as an iron source.
